The petite qipaos are designed with meticulous attention to detail. They are tailored to fit a smaller frame without compromising on style or elegance. The length of these qipaos is often adjusted to suit the height of the wearer, ensuring that every inch is accentuated beautifully. The cuts are sleek and modern, often featuring contemporary elements like short sleeves or asymmetric designs.
The use of materials is also innovative. While traditional cheongsam were often made from silk or other luxurious fabrics, modern petite qipaos blend traditional materials with contemporary ones like lightweight cotton or breathable synthetic fibers. This ensures that the garment not only looks stunning but also provides comfort for everyday wear.
The color palette of these young qipaos is also quite varied. While traditional hues like red, black, and gold remain popular, designers are also experimenting with more vibrant colors like bright pinks, deep blues, and even playful patterns like floral prints or abstract designs.
